Blade Machines vs. Sliding Saws: Which is Best for Aluminum?

When shaping aluminum profiles, the decision between an upcut saw and a miter saw can be significant. Generally, upcut saws often provide a cleaner, less tear-out finish on aluminum compared to miter saws. This is because the blade's upward cutting action helps prevent the material from grabbing or splintering. However, miter saws, especially those equipped with non-ferrous metal blades and scoring capabilities, can also deliver decent results, although they may require more careful technique to minimize burrs. Finally, for frequent or professional aluminum work, a dedicated upcut saw is often the superior option; otherwise, a miter saw with appropriate blade selection can be a acceptable alternative.

Achieving Alloy Cuts with Your Machine and Miter Cutoff

Working with metal can be a hurdle if you're not careful, but achieving accurate cuts is entirely possible with the right approach . This guide will explore how to effectively utilize your circular saw and miter saw for optimal results. First, ensure your blade is specifically designed for non-ferrous metals – a high tooth count (typically 60 or more) minimizes burring . Configuring the speed correctly is also vital; slower speeds generally produce finer cuts. Remember to use lubrication, like cutting fluid or lubricant , to reduce friction and heat buildup, which can cause the material to warp or discolor. Don't forget proper safety precautions: always wear eye protection and a dust mask! Here are some key tips:

  • Employ a slow feed rate for better cuts.
  • Maintain your blade sharp and clean.
  • Test on scrap pieces first to dial in your settings.
  • Firmly hold the alloy work piece before cutting.

With a little practice and these techniques, you’ll be producing professional-quality cuts in no time.
